Fashion Tips from TSA


TSA is giving everyone fashion tips on what to wear to the airports while traveling. The new TSA screening and pat-down regulations has everyone wondering what's the right type of clothing to wear to expedite the screening process.

TSA advices to avoid wearing skirts, and clothes that have too many metal studs or beads. Also be careful of what kind of bra you are wearing, the metal wire in the bra may cause some problems with the TSA screening. The new search technique allows airport security screeners to use their palms and fingers to probe for hidden weapons and devices around sensitive body parts, including clothed genital areas and breasts (msnbc).

One more tip, experts say, is to avoid baggy clothes. They may attract unwanted attention, especially if you could potentially be "hiding" something underneath all those clothes (msnbc)
